What Is Security?
At its most basic level, security refers to the state of convenientbetter free from danger or threat. This definition can be expanded into various contexts:
-
Physical security involves protecting people and tangible assets (homes, buildings, critical infrastructure).
-
Cybersecurity addresses the protection of digital assets and networks.
-
National security relates to a country's efforts to protect itself from internal and external threats.
-
Personal security focuses on an individual's safety, privacy, and well-being.
-
Economic security ensures individuals or nations have stable income or resources to support their needs.
Each form of security requires unique strategies, technologies, and mindsets, yet they all share a fundamental goal: to minimize risk and protect value.
The Historical Context of Security
Historically, security was largely a physical matter—cities built walls, individuals armed themselves, and armies protected nations. In pre-industrial times, threats were often visible and direct. However, the 20th and 21st centuries brought a shift in the nature of threats:
-
World Wars and the Cold War emphasized the importance of military and nuclear security.
-
The Internet Revolution of the 1990s and 2000s introduced the need for cybersecurity.
-
The post-9/11 era ushered in a focus on counter-terrorism and homeland security.
-
The COVID-19 pandemic added biosecurity and health security to the global agenda.
This evolution has made security a pervasive theme in both public policy and private enterprise.
Key Types of Security
1. Cybersecurity
With the digitization of nearly every aspect of life, cybersecurity has become one of the most crucial forms of security. It includes:
-
Network Security: Protecting internal networks from intrusions and misuse.
-
Endpoint Security: Safeguarding individual devices such as computers and smartphones.
-
Cloud Security: Securing data stored and processed in cloud environments.
-
Application Security: Ensuring that software applications are free of vulnerabilities.
-
Information Security: Protecting sensitive data from unauthorized access or disclosure.
Common threats in cybersecurity include malware, ransomware, phishing attacks, data breaches, and denial-of-service (DoS) attacks.
2. Physical Security
Physical security is the oldest form of protection and involves:
-
Access Control Systems: Including locks, biometrics, and security guards.
-
Surveillance: Using CCTV cameras, motion detectors, and drones.
-
Environmental Design: Designing infrastructure to minimize threats (e.g., lighting, fencing, barriers).
-
Emergency Response: Fire safety systems, alarms, and evacuation plans.
Physical security remains critical in protecting critical infrastructure, businesses, and homes.

Emerging Threats in the Security Landscape
1. AI and Automation
Artificial intelligence offers powerful tools for security (like facial recognition and threat detection), but it also introduces risks such as:
-
AI-generated phishing emails.
-
Deepfakes used for identity fraud or misinformation.
-
Autonomous drones being weaponized.
2. Cybercrime-as-a-Service
Today, even non-technical criminals can rent hacking tools and services on the dark web. This industrialization of cybercrime increases risk for individuals and small businesses.
3. Climate Change
Environmental security is increasingly seen as a national concern. Climate-driven resource scarcity can lead to migration crises, political instability, and conflict.
4. Supply Chain Attacks
Rather than attacking a company directly, cybercriminals increasingly exploit weaknesses in third-party vendors. The SolarWinds and Log4j incidents are prime examples.
Strategies for Building a Secure Future
Security is not just the responsibility of governments or IT departments. It’s a shared duty. Here are some critical strategies:
1. Defense in Depth
A layered approach to security ensures that if one barrier fails, others remain intact. For example, a company might have:
-
Firewall → Antivirus software → Access controls → User training → Incident response plan
2. Security by Design
Rather than adding security features after development, modern systems are increasingly built with security as a foundational principle.
3. User Education
Many breaches occur due to human error. Teaching users about phishing, strong passwords, and data privacy can significantly reduce risks.
4. Incident Response Plans
Organizations should assume that breaches will happen and prepare detailed action plans to minimize damage and restore operations quickly.
5. Collaboration and Intelligence Sharing
Governments, tech companies, and security firms must share threat intelligence to stay ahead of rapidly evolving threats.
